Transaction dd273da978b5e6bf7942ec495857230f2380bac795f1f79dbf47a1841f87fe0e
1 Input
1 Output
-
dd273da978b5e6bf7942ec495857230f2380bac795f1f79dbf47a1841f87fe0e:0
- value
- 253798624
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2b52128e32056316c045fbc006d80474dce766e
- address
- bc1qu26jz28ryptrzmqyt77qqmvqgaxuuanwvwan9w